Assemblage et vinification
Château Lafite-Rothschild relies on meticulous parcel selection, drawing its identity from deep, warm gravels that guarantee perfect drainage and homogeneous phenolic ripeness. The 1995 harvest, marked by an exceptional balance between concentration and freshness, produced grapes of exemplary purity. Vinification, in full respect of the fruit, favors gentle extraction to preserve the elegance of the structure. Ageing in new oak barrels provides that characteristic polish, a noble roundness where soft spices and a subtle touch of vanilla meld without ever overpowering the fruit. At the end of this patient craftsmanship, the wine presents itself straight, precise and admirably coherent, ready to interact with air and time to reveal its full dimension.
Notes de dégustation
- Appearance : Deep garnet with time‑softened highlights, clear and vibrant, suggesting a perfectly controlled density.
- Nose : Complex and noble, combining cedar, cigar box and fresh tobacco with dark fruits, blackcurrant and currant, and a hint of graphite that underlines Pauillac’s elegance.
- Palate : A caressing attack, a broad yet taut mid-palate, tannins as fine as taffeta, and a sovereign finish that prolongs blackcurrant, spices and precious wood into a long, harmonious finale.
Température de service et conseils
Serve this Pauillac at cellar temperature (slightly below typical room temperature) to preserve its aromatic freshness and the nobility of its structure. A gentle decanting, without haste, allows the bouquet to open up and gradually reveal the mosaic of aromas that define it. Store the bottle away from light, lying down, in a cool, stable cellar. Fully expressive today, the 1995 still retains energy that will allow it to continue evolving in the glass for those who can offer it attentive rest.
